Oswego Drag Raceway was a legendary quarter-mile drag strip in Oswego, Illinois, that opened in 1955 and helped put the small Fox Valley community on the map. It became a major destination for Chicago-area racing fans, regularly drawing thousands of spectators to see famous drivers and powerful dragsters. The track hosted races for more than two decades before closing in 1979. Today, the Oswego Drag Raceway is fondly remembered through reunions, memorabilia, and the stories of the racers and fans who experienced it.
